AMD Radeon R7 260X vs NVIDIA L20
AMD Radeon R7 260X vs NVIDIA L20
VS
AMD Radeon R7 260X
NVIDIA L20
We compared two Desktop platform GPUs: 2GB VRAM Radeon R7 260X and 48GB VRAM L20 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on R7 260X 's Advantages
Lower TDP (115W vs 275W)
NVIDIA L20 's Advantages
Released 10 years and 1 months late
Boost Clock2520MHz
More VRAM (48GB vs 2GB)
Larger VRAM bandwidth (864.0GB/s vs 104.0GB/s)
10880 additional rendering cores
